Output 5276661d63b1e08ea589dc0525f21f8e21930b9cd839fde9e492d40c1f111f05:1

value
3223981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efa2cd35e6b370bab25f08489455529272b22e9e OP_EQUAL
address
3PY6T3ZVJD4vSUgi5hbcjespsBhBxEAEFt
transaction
5276661d63b1e08ea589dc0525f21f8e21930b9cd839fde9e492d40c1f111f05
spent
true